diff options
Diffstat (limited to 'web_src/less')
-rw-r--r-- | web_src/less/_repository.less | 17 |
1 files changed, 15 insertions, 2 deletions
diff --git a/web_src/less/_repository.less b/web_src/less/_repository.less index ccc2dcf69c..ffec4043b5 100644 --- a/web_src/less/_repository.less +++ b/web_src/less/_repository.less @@ -1,6 +1,19 @@ .repository { - .commit-statuses .list > .item { - line-height: 2; + .popup.commit-statuses { + // we had better limit the max size of the popup, and add scroll bars if the content size is too large. + // otherwise some part of the popup will be hidden by viewport boundary + max-height: 45vh; + max-width: 60vw; + overflow: auto; + padding: 0; + + .list { + padding: .8em; // to make the scrollbar align to the border, we move the padding from outer `.popup` to this inside `.list` + + > .item { + line-height: 2; + } + } } .repo-header { |